Tencent open-sources Team Memory beta for shared context across multi-agent AI teams
Tencent has launched the beta of Team Memory, an open-source extension of its Agent Memory project that lets multiple AI agents share governed memory assets through a central hub. The system supports assets including chat memory, skills, document-based wiki entries, and code graphs, with access controls that determine which agents or team members can read each asset. Early discussion around the release has focused on a current gap: while Team Memory includes ownership and visibility controls, its documentation does not yet describe a correction or expiry process for wrong or conflicting memories once they propagate across a team.

Report says Amazon is cutting back parts of its internal AI effort after struggles with Nova
Futurism reports that Amazon is scaling back parts of its AI organization tied to its in-house model efforts after sustained setbacks. The article centers on internal retrenchment around Amazon's generative AI work, including the Nova model family, rather than a product launch or financing announcement.
